Sansa Fuze Plus Problems
(1/1)
RaldyV:
My Rockboxed Sansa Fuze Plus never turns on. So I charge it. Immediately I get sent to Bootloader USB Mode. It doesn't even say whether or not it's charging past that point. So I unplug it and sure enough it's stuck. So I turn it off and it doesn't turn back on. silvertree:
My immediate reaction is that there is something wrong with the battery.
You can test this by plugging the unit into a strictly charging only device, such as those USB wall chargers that come with phones.
If all is well, the boot loader should detect no USB host and boot directly into Rockbox. Once RB is running, disconnect the charging cable. If it powers off immediately, I'd be convinced it is a battery issue.
What does the device do if you attempted to power it up while holding the volume down key?
There are numerous other issues to explore but we'll need a plethora of more information before that can happen. Did it work before, what lead up to this failure, is the .rockbox folder preent and intact, etc.?
BTW, if the device enters USB mode while connected to a PC your songs are still intact and can, at the very least, be rescued for use on another device.

monoid:
I would add, that if the Fuze+ goes off after removal of USB charger, next recomended step is to start Fuze+ in OF (using USB charger) and let it chargé for some time.
It has happened to me that Fuze+ to keep chargé, respectively the battery was discharged and it was not possible to chargé it in RB. It reseted after a minute or so and restarted afrer some time again and endlessly so on. I thought, the battery was dead or Fuze+ was somehow deffective.... But charging in OF resolved all problems.
I am not sure, but it seems to me that need to chargé in OF has already occured several times (2 or 3) to me. It might be unique to my device or there is some kind of ability of RB firmware to be improved. (I am very happy and satisfied with RB and this behaviour does not make me problems and if it randomly occures it has easy solution).
My guess is that the issue has something to do with discharging of battery under certain limit. In that case, IMO, the code of RB for Fuze+ responsible for charging fails to deliver battery charging.
metaphys:
I would recommend starting by charging with original firmware:
- press volume down button and keep it pressed.
- plug the USB
- wait for the original firmware charging screen to come up while keeping volume down pressed. (if your battery is really down this can take several minutes, so be patient)
once screen show up you can release the button and let your device charge for a while to get it out of the red zone
